图像分割是计算机视觉领域的一个重要分支,它旨在将图像中的不同区域或对象进行分离和识别。这项技术在医学影像分析、自动驾驶、遥感图像处理等领域有着广泛的应用。近年来,随着深度学习技术的快速发展,图像分割领域也取得了显著的突破。本文将深入解析图像分割的最新研究现状与突破进展。
一、传统图像分割方法
在深度学习技术兴起之前,图像分割主要依赖于传统的方法,如基于边缘检测、区域生长、阈值分割等。这些方法在处理简单图像时具有一定的效果,但在面对复杂场景和大规模数据时,往往难以达到令人满意的结果。
1. 边缘检测
边缘检测是图像分割的基础,它通过寻找图像中像素值变化的剧烈点来提取边缘信息。常见的边缘检测算法有Sobel算子、Canny算子等。
2. 区域生长
区域生长算法将图像中的像素点根据某种相似性准则(如颜色、纹理等)进行分组,形成不同的区域。这种方法在处理纹理丰富的图像时效果较好。
3. 阈值分割
阈值分割算法通过设置一个阈值,将图像中的像素点分为前景和背景两部分。这种方法在处理具有明显对比度的图像时效果较好。
二、基于深度学习的图像分割方法
随着深度学习技术的快速发展,基于深度学习的图像分割方法逐渐成为主流。这些方法利用神经网络强大的特征提取和分类能力,在图像分割任务中取得了显著的成果。
1. 卷积神经网络(CNN)
卷积神经网络(CNN)是图像分割领域最常用的深度学习模型。通过卷积层、池化层和全连接层等结构,CNN能够自动学习图像中的特征,实现对图像的分割。
2. 轻量级网络
为了提高图像分割的速度和降低计算成本,研究人员提出了许多轻量级网络结构,如MobileNet、ShuffleNet等。这些网络在保证分割精度的同时,大大降低了计算复杂度。
3. 语义分割
语义分割是指将图像中的每个像素点都赋予一个语义标签,如车辆、行人、道路等。在语义分割任务中,常用的模型有FCN(全卷积网络)、U-Net等。
4. 实例分割
实例分割旨在将图像中的每个对象都分割出来,并标注出其边界框。目前,实例分割领域最常用的模型是Mask R-CNN。
三、最新研究现状与突破进展
1. 多尺度特征融合
为了提高图像分割的精度,研究人员提出了多种多尺度特征融合方法,如FPN(特征金字塔网络)、PSPNet(位置敏感池化网络)等。这些方法能够有效地融合不同尺度的特征,提高分割精度。
2. 上下文信息利用
上下文信息在图像分割中起着至关重要的作用。为了充分利用上下文信息,研究人员提出了许多基于注意力机制的模型,如SENet(Squeeze-and-Excitation Networks)、CBAM(Convolutional Block Attention Module)等。
3. 可解释性研究
随着深度学习模型在图像分割领域的广泛应用,可解释性研究成为了一个重要方向。研究人员致力于提高模型的可解释性,使模型的行为更加透明,便于理解和优化。
4. 基于自监督学习的图像分割
自监督学习是一种无需标注数据的深度学习技术。近年来,基于自监督学习的图像分割方法取得了显著的进展,如SimCLR(Supervised Contrastive Learning)、MoCo(Memory Consistency Object Re-Identification)等。
四、总结
图像分割技术在计算机视觉领域具有重要的应用价值。随着深度学习技术的不断发展,图像分割领域取得了显著的突破。未来,随着研究的不断深入,图像分割技术将在更多领域发挥重要作用。
